What's a better way to beat Ludicolo by using the same mon to beat it!? Introducing: Assault Vest, Rain Dish Ludicolo.
LO Ludicolo can't 4HKO against it (adding Rain Dish in), and AV Ludicolo's Giga Drain does more damage than receiving it from LO Ludicolo.
RD and Giga Drain recovers you around 18-20% back.
With Knock Off to get rid of Life Orb, the Ludicolo can't even 5hko, barely 6HKO it. Not like it matters anyway as life orb puts Ludicolo in range of getting 3HKO. So you can run Fake Out to stall out rain or scald for utility.

This is why I nominate AV Ludicolo as a soft(?) counter.

dragonvally is a really bad check; assuming ludicolo is at full and under rain, you dont even ohko ludi after it the recoil it takes from life orb. if you're lucky and get a max roll you trade with ludi after life orb recoil, but honestly i wouldnt even consider it a check. if ludi gets a high roll on ice beam, dragonvally is in range of giga, which means you dont even beat it.
